大家好,今天我們要來談?wù)撘幌翷inux系統(tǒng)中的雙網(wǎng)卡綁定,也就是bond0。
我們知道,現(xiàn)在很多服務(wù)器都有多個網(wǎng)卡,這些網(wǎng)卡可以同時進行負載均衡和冗余備份。在使用雙網(wǎng)卡時,需要將這些網(wǎng)卡進行綁定,創(chuàng)建一個bond0接口,以實現(xiàn)雙網(wǎng)卡的共同使用。
先說一下如何配置bond0。
首先,打開終端輸入:ifconfig -a ,列出當前系統(tǒng)所有的網(wǎng)卡信息??梢钥吹剑覀冇袃蓧K網(wǎng)卡eth0和eth1。
然后,編輯網(wǎng)卡設(shè)置文件:sudo vi /etc/network/interfaces ,找到eth0和eth1的配置,將它們都修改為:
auto eth0
iface eth0 inet manual
bond-master bond0
auto eth1
iface eth1 inet manual
bond-master bond0
然后在同一個文件中添加下面的配置:
auto bond0
iface bond0 inet static
address 192.168.0.10
netmask 255.255.255.0
gateway 192.168.0.1
bond-mode 802.3ad
bond-miimon 100
bond-lacp-rate fast
bond-slaves none
解釋一下上面的配置:
address:設(shè)定bond0接口的IP地址
netmask:設(shè)定bond0接口的子網(wǎng)掩碼
gateway:設(shè)定bond0接口的網(wǎng)關(guān)地址
bond-mode:指定綁定模式,這里設(shè)為802.3ad
bond-miimon:設(shè)定鏈路監(jiān)視器檢查鏈路狀況的時間間隔,這里設(shè)為100ms
bond-lacp-rate:設(shè)定LACP控制幀發(fā)送的速率,這里設(shè)為fast
bond-slaves:指定哪些網(wǎng)卡要綁定到bond0接口上,這里是none,因為現(xiàn)在還沒有指定。
完成上述配置后,保存文件并關(guān)閉。
然后重啟網(wǎng)絡(luò)服務(wù):sudo service network-manager restart。
接下來再重新啟動網(wǎng)卡:sudo ifup bond0。
如果一切順利,通過ifconfig -a命令,我們應(yīng)該可以看到bond0接口,以及eth0和eth1網(wǎng)卡都已經(jīng)加入到bond0中。如下圖所示:
至此,我們就成功地將雙網(wǎng)卡綁定在一起了。
那么雙網(wǎng)卡綁定有什么作用呢?
首先,雙網(wǎng)卡綁定能夠提供更加穩(wěn)定的網(wǎng)絡(luò)連接和更高的網(wǎng)絡(luò)帶寬。因為兩個網(wǎng)卡可以同時進行傳輸數(shù)據(jù),這樣可以避免單一網(wǎng)卡帶寬被占滿的情況,從而提高傳輸速度和穩(wěn)定性。
其次,雙網(wǎng)卡綁定還可以提供冗余備份。如果綁定的其中一個網(wǎng)卡出現(xiàn)故障,另一個網(wǎng)卡仍然可以正常工作,確保系統(tǒng)的網(wǎng)絡(luò)連接不中斷,從而提高了系統(tǒng)的可靠性。
總結(jié)一下,雙網(wǎng)卡綁定對于服務(wù)器來說非常重要,它可以提高網(wǎng)絡(luò)帶寬和穩(wěn)定性,同時還可以提供冗余備份,極大地提高了系統(tǒng)的可靠性。所以,有多個網(wǎng)卡的服務(wù)器一定要學(xué)會如何綁定雙網(wǎng)卡。 yinyiprinting.cn 寧波海美seo網(wǎng)絡(luò)優(yōu)化公司 是網(wǎng)頁設(shè)計制作,網(wǎng)站優(yōu)化,企業(yè)關(guān)鍵詞排名,網(wǎng)絡(luò)營銷知識和開發(fā)愛好者的一站式目的地,提供豐富的信息、資源和工具來幫助用戶創(chuàng)建令人驚嘆的實用網(wǎng)站。 該平臺致力于提供實用、相關(guān)和最新的內(nèi)容,這使其成為初學(xué)者和經(jīng)驗豐富的專業(yè)人士的寶貴資源。
聲明本文內(nèi)容來自網(wǎng)絡(luò),若涉及侵權(quán),請聯(lián)系我們刪除! 投稿需知:請以word形式發(fā)送至郵箱[email protected]
不錯呀,感謝展會老師哈